+function CPD = tabular_decision_node(bnet, self, CPT)
+% TABULAR_DECISION_NODE Represent a stochastic policy over a discrete decision/action node as a table
+% CPD = tabular_decision_node(bnet, self, CPT)
+%
+% node is the number of a node in this equivalence class.
+% CPT is an optional argument (see tabular_CPD for details); by default, it is the uniform policy.
+
+if nargin==0
+  % This occurs if we are trying to load an object from a file.
+  CPD = init_fields;
+  CPD = class(CPD, 'tabular_decision_node', discrete_CPD(1, []));
+  return;
+elseif isa(bnet, 'tabular_decision_node')
+  % This might occur if we are copying an object.
+  CPD = bnet;
+  return;
+end
+CPD = init_fields;
+
+ns = bnet.node_sizes;
+fam = family(bnet.dag, self);
+ps = parents(bnet.dag, self);
+sz = ns(fam);
+
+if nargin < 3
+  CPT = mk_stochastic(myones(sz)); 
+else
+  CPT = myreshape(CPT, sz);
+end
+
+CPD.CPT = CPT;
+CPD.sizes = sz; 
+
+clamped = 1; % don't update using EM
+CPD = class(CPD, 'tabular_decision_node', discrete_CPD(clamped, ns([ps self])));
+
+%%%%%%%%%%%
+
+function CPD = init_fields()
+% This ensures we define the fields in the same order 
+% no matter whether we load an object from a file,
+% or create it from scratch. (Matlab requires this.)
+
+CPD.CPT = [];
+CPD.sizes = [];
